張詠翔 (Sean Chang)

Sr. Data Scientist

Sr. Data Scientist at KKLab, KKBOX Group

  Taipei, Taiwan

https://www.seanchang.space         

技能

ML Fundamentals


  • tree-based models (bagging, boosting)
  • NLP-related models (LM, NER, SA, ...)

Programming Languages


  • Python
  • JavaScript
  • Scala
  • Go

Frontend


  • React
  • React Native

Backend & Database


  • Express
  • Flask & FastAPI
  • SQLAlchemy
  • MongoDB
  • MySQL

DevOps


  • Docker
  • Kubernetes
  • AWS
  • Ansible
  • Helm
  • GitLab CI

Distributed Computing


  • Apache Spark

ML Frameworks & MLOps


  • Tensorflow
  • Scikit-learn
  • Spark ML
  • mlflow
  • spaCy

Data Visualization


  • Plotly
  • D3.js
  • seaborn
  • bokeh

Miscellaneous


  • Scrapy & Beautiful Soup

工作經歷


Sr. Data Scientist

KKBOX

四月 2020 - Present
Taipei, Taiwan

- adapt Aveva PRiSM to a tier 1 company in Taiwan for anomaly detection on their producing pipelines.
- engage in a venture building project related to NLP and develop its algorithms and models.
- win 1st place in IMBD 2020 which is a competition related to manufacturing.
- maintain and develop KKBOX opinion mining system and sell it to other companies (SAAS).

Data Scientist

KKBOX

九月 2018 - 四月 2020
Taipei, Taiwan

- build public opinion mining system by novel NLP models.
* build novel NLP models such as BERT-BiLSTM-CRF, ConvNet and TNet by TensorFlow.
* maintain, design NLP pipelines for opinion mining system.
* build the frontend page which can monitor artist's social volumes by React.
* build restful api by Flask, gunicorn.
* deploy this microservice by docker stack (docker-compose)
- maintain app's event log specification and analyze user actions.
- win 3rd place in KKBOX inhouse hackathon. we build a social network app called KKMeet which can recommend you new friends by your music preferences.

學歷

2016 - 2018

National Taiwan University

Economics

Thesis: Lyrics- and Audio Features-based Hit Song Prediction